What to Expect from the Simon Cabaret Show

The Simon Cabaret Show in Phuket is a spectacle designed to dazzle and amuse. Expect a well-lit stage full of extravagant costumes, often with shimmering sequins, feathers, and vibrant colors. The show’s core is a lively combination of musical numbers and comedic routines, often with a humorous edge that appeals to a broad audience.

The Itinerary and Experience
Once you arrive, you’ll show your pre-purchased ticket at the entrance and take your seat in an intimate theater setting. The venue is designed to make viewers feel close to the stage, which helps enhance the overall experience. Depending on your chosen showtime—either 6 PM, 7:30 PM, or 9 PM—you’ll be treated to about two hours of lively performances.
The performers are known for their glamorous costumes and energetic routines. The show is primarily a musical and comedy revue, with acts that showcase glamour, humor, and high-energy dance routines. According to one reviewer, the music includes songs from different Asian countries, adding a nice multicultural touch.
The Visual and Audio Impact
One of the show’s highlights is its use of high-tech lighting and sound equipment. This creates a vibrant, immersive atmosphere that keeps audiences engaged. The set designs are colorful, lively, and designed to wow audiences, though some find the costumes a little “tired,” suggesting they could use an update to match the impressive lighting.
Audience and Group Sizes
With a maximum of 200 travelers, the show maintains a lively yet manageable atmosphere. It’s usually suitable for most travelers, including families with children, as long as they’re comfortable with the show’s lively, glamorous style.

Practical Tips for Visiting the Simon Cabaret Show

- Book in advance: It seems most travelers reserve about 20 days ahead to secure their preferred showtime.
- Choose your showtime wisely: Evening performances range from 6 PM to 9 PM. Consider your dinner plans or how late you want to stay out.
- Upgrade for transfers: If convenience is your priority, opting for the round-trip transfer package is worthwhile.
- No photos or recording inside: Cameras and recording devices are not permitted during the show, so enjoy the moment.
- Arrive early: To find your seat and get settled before the show begins.
- Children’s tickets: Available for ages 4-12, with a maximum height of 140 cm, making it accessible for families.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Is there a dress code for the Simon Cabaret Show?
There’s no strict dress code, but casual or smart casual attire is recommended. Since it’s an entertainment venue, dress comfortably but neatly.
Can I buy tickets on the day of the show?
It’s best to book in advance, especially during peak seasons, to secure your preferred showtime and avoid disappointment.
Are children allowed to attend?
Yes, children aged 4-12 can attend, with a maximum height of 140 cm. Check if the show content is suitable for younger children, as it can be lively.
Does the ticket price include food or drinks?
No, the ticket only grants entry to the show. Food and drinks are not included and are available for purchase separately.
What is the duration of the performance?
The show lasts approximately 2 hours, including any intermissions or breaks.
Are transfers necessary?
Transfers are optional. If you choose to include round-trip transfers, they will be arranged from your hotel; otherwise, you’ll need to organize your own transportation.
Is the show accessible for people with mobility issues?
Most travelers can participate, but it’s advisable to confirm access arrangements if you have specific mobility needs.
